Overview: Join our team as a Wireless System Characterization Engineer where you will play a pivotal role in integrating and characterizing wireless systems. Work with cutting-edge technologies to assess wireless performance, specifically focusing on Wi-Fi and Bluetooth standards. You will develop and execute test plans to ensure optimal throughput, signal strength, and power consumption, impacting the development and testing phases of emerging consumer electronics products, such as AR, VR, and Smart Glasses.
Responsibilities:
- Develop and execute comprehensive test plans, focusing on wireless system integration, performance metrics, and power consumption.
- Conduct throughput testing in conducted setups and perform link quality measurements on-body (emerging AI-enabled wearable devices) to evaluate wireless performance.
- Utilize RF measurement equipment to assess signal strength and power consumption under varying wireless link use cases.
- Analyze lab measurement data and create reports to be used for re-design or optimization of wireless solutions in such devices.
- Collaborate with cross-functional teams—including hardware, software, and design—to ensure accurate characterization and seamless integration of wireless systems.
- Leverage Python and MATLAB to script and automate testing processes for efficient characterization of wireless technologies.
